Hong Kong is not to be given independence like other Bish colonies. The grant of full British nationality to the ethnic minorities in Hong Kong would not create an undesirable precedent for other British colonies or territories.
(g) Like many Hong Kong people, the ethnic minorities regard Hong Kong as their home. It is their intention to stay in Hong Kong as far as possible. They do not anticipate migrating to Britain if they are granted full British citizenship. The British. Government should have no concern about major influx of such immigrants.
Recommendation
The Legislative Council concludes that the British Government has an obligation to provide proper citizenship (ie British citizenship) to this group of non-Chinese ethnic minorities in Hong Kong who are British nationals. It recommends that they should be granted full British nationality without further delay.
